Orpheus in England

14th August 2023

Orpheus in England

Lute songs and continuo songs by three of the greatest songsmiths of the 17th century: John Dowland, Henry Lawes and Henry Purcell. With Alysha Paterson (soprano) and Din Ghani (lute and archlute).

Tudor Dance workshop

9th August 2023

Tudor Dance workshop

Do you know the difference between a Pavane and a Brawle? Did you know that Shakespeare mentioned both music and dance in several plays, including Romeo and Juliet, Twelfth Night, Much Ado About Nothing? He even included dance in the stage directions!

Come to the Charterhouse for a unique opportunity to discover some of the music and dances from the age of the Tudors and have a go yourself, to live music.

Plucked Byrd

26th May 2023

Plucked Byrd

Musicke in the Ayre resume their concert series in the Chapel with a programme marking the 400th anniversary of the death of William Byrd, one of the foremost composers of the Tudor period. Byrd did not write for the lute – most of his secular songs were originally written as part-songs or consort songs: for their “Plucked Byrd” programme soprano Jane Hunt and lutenist Din Ghani will perform some gorgeous examples of his work, arranged for voice and lute. They also include works by his close associates Thomas Tallis and Thomas Morley. Din will also play some of his keyboard music arranged for solo lute.
